What Daniels Heating and Air Conditioning Inspects During Your Heat Pump Service

Our heat pump inspection in Winterville is thorough, examining every vital component to ensure your system performs safely and efficiently.

System Performance and Operation

We evaluate how well the heat pump circulates warm air and maintains your desired indoor temperature. This inspection includes checking:

  • Heating capacity relative to thermostat settings
  • Proper cycling and defrost mode operation
  • Noise levels indicative of mechanical issues

Refrigerant Levels and Condition

Correct refrigerant charge is critical to heat pump efficiency and longevity. Our technicians test refrigerant pressure to determine if it falls within manufacturer specifications, identifying leaks or undercharging early on.

Electrical Components and Connections

Heat pumps rely on complex electrical systems. We inspect:

  • Wiring integrity for signs of wear or damage
  • Contactors and relays for proper engagement
  • Capacitors and controls for reliable startup and operation
  • Safety switches and sensors to ensure correct function

Safety Controls and Mechanisms

A malfunctioning heat pump can present serious hazards. Our inspection includes safety checks for:

  • Overcurrent protection devices
  • Temperature sensors and limit switches
  • Proper grounding and bonding

Ductwork Condition and Airflow

Inefficient or damaged ductwork compromises heat pump performance and indoor air quality. We examine duct connections, insulation, and detect leaks or blockages that restrict airflow.

Common Heat Pump Issues in Winterville Uncovered During Inspections

Our comprehensive inspections often reveal common problems specific to the local climate and usage patterns, such as:

  • Refrigerant leaks caused by age or mechanical wear
  • Frozen coils or defrost cycle failures linked to high humidity and frost accumulation
  • Electrical component fatigue from frequent cycling in colder weather
  • Duct leakage due to settling or moisture damage in humid conditions
  • Compressor or fan motor issues arising from heavy seasonal load

Early diagnosis ensures tailored repairs that restore full system function and reduce ongoing maintenance frequency.

Tips for Maximizing Heat Pump Efficiency Between Inspections

While professional inspections keep your system in peak shape, homeowners in Winterville can support efficiency by:

  • Changing or cleaning air filters regularly to ensure proper airflow
  • Keeping outdoor coils free from debris and ice buildup
  • Sealing windows and doors to reduce heat loss
  • Using programmable thermostats to optimize heating schedules
  • Keeping vents unobstructed and open for uniform heating distribution
